全球邮箱账号生成算法:技术深度解析

作者:admin 日期:2024-10-20 浏览:28
EchoData
广告
当然,关于全球邮箱账号生成算法的技术解析,我将用轻松幽默的方式来介绍这个主题。希望你在阅读的过程中能找到一些有趣的点,也能学到一些新知识。

邮箱账号的基本构成

大家都知道,邮箱地址通常由**用户名**和**域名**两部分组成。例如,在[email protected]中,example是**用户名**,gmail.com是**域名**。要生成一个邮箱账号,首先得决定这两部分的内容。

用户名生成

用户名可以包含字母、数字以及某些特定符号(如点号和下划线),但不能包含空格和其他特殊符号。为了生成一个唯一的用户名,算法通常会结合用户的姓名、生日以及随机数。例如,像"xiaoyu2024"这样的用户名,听起来是不是既亲切又有点科技感?

当然,对于一些特别活泼的用户,他们可能会选择"super_cool_xiaoyu"这样更个性化的名字。生成算法会考虑用户的偏好和已有的用户名列表,确保不重复。

域名的选择

选择合适的域名也是邮箱生成的关键。全球知名的域名提供商有很多,比如gmail.com、yahoo.com、outlook.com等。根据用户的需求和地域,算法会选择合适的域名。例如,企业用户可能更倾向于使用公司自有域名,而个人用户可能更喜欢主流的公共域名。

安全性与验证

在生成邮箱账号时,**安全性**永远是第一位的。算法需要确保生成的账号不会被轻易猜测或攻击。通常会加入密码强度检测机制,确保用户设置的密码足够强大。此外,还会通过邮件或短信验证确保账号的真实性。

技术实现

要实现这些功能,算法通常会使用编程语言如Python、Java或JavaScript等。通过正则表达式来验证用户名格式,使用随机数生成器来确保唯一性,以及通过API接口与域名提供商通信来注册账号。

整个过程看似复杂,但其实也充满乐趣。就像在搭积木一样,每一个细节都需要精雕细琢,才能搭建出一个**安全**、**可靠**的邮箱系统。

未来发展

随着技术的不断进步,邮箱账号生成算法也在不断演变。未来可能会加入更多的人工智能元素,自动为用户推荐最合适的用户名和域名,还能智能检测用户的语言和文化背景,提供个性化服务。

总之,无论技术如何变化,邮箱都将继续在我们的数字生活中扮演重要角色。而这些看似简单的算法背后,其实隐藏着巨大的智慧与努力。

希望这篇文章能让你对全球邮箱账号生成算法有一个清晰的了解,也期待你在日常生活中发现更多有趣的科技小秘密!😊

EchoData短信群发
广告
EchoData筛号
广告